Claim for pay due John Harris
07/31/1786 Autograph Letter SignedOrder to deliver the pay due to John Harris - soldier in the Continental Army during the Revolutionary War - to Richard Anderson.
Miscellaneous Numbered Records (Manuscript File) 1775-1790's. (RG93) (M859)
